Where is the best place to purchase a new speedo drive and cable ?

just explored why mine wasn't working and I think its the wrong one ...... am I right in saying the red one is for 17" supermoto and black for 21" rims .
mine has a red one on 21" and assume missing the drive lugs even though its wrong one ..

Posted Image

Also there seems to be a locating notch on the outer case but nothing to locate it too ?

do you just put it in position and nip the axle up ?

no lugs on the outer, as its also a wheel spacer, it is held tight when the spindle is tightened via the 17mm bolt on the left side, so position it well to be able to remove the speedo cable
